The importance of preselling
If you want to make more money as an affiliate, you must presell.
Before we begin, we need to first define what preselling is. Well, it is an art. And it’s also a science. It’s a process of taking your reader and getting them ready to buy. Then when they’re ready, refer them to the product website so they can buy it. And if it’s done properly, the process is completely sub-conscious.
In a nutshell, you provide value. And then refer them to the product website. We’ll get into how to do it correctly in a minute. Before we get into that, you should understand what’s in it for you. Just a few of the reasons you want to presell.
- It builds trust – Readers who trust you are more likely to click your links. And the more traffic you can send to the sale page, the more commissions you’ll earn.
- It disarms your reader – Nobody likes to be sold something. By not doing that to them, your reader is less defensive. Unguarded reading means they’re not filtering what you say. So your content get absorbed.
- It puts them in a buying mood – Your readers are now receiving your message. So they become more receptive to other messages. This includes the sales website you send them to! Sending them to the sales page in this state makes them more receptive to the actual pitch.
- You make more money – They arrive at the product website prepped to buy. With a feeling of trust and openness. This dramatically boosts your sales rate!
- Your customers are happier – People like to make their own buying decisions. Instead of feeling pressured or “sold”. So they are happier with their purchase.
- Your profits go up – A satisfied customer doesn’t ask for a refund. Less refunds means more affiliate money stays in your pocket.
Obviously, it’s important to presell. You increase your profits. And produce happier customers. That’s a clear win-win.
OK, so how do you do it?
You’ve learned the importance of preselling. And hopefully you’re convinced you need to start doing it. You’re ready to learn how to do it properly. Remember, there are two components – art and science.
The art of preselling
The first step is in getting your readers to trust you and open up. This can only be accomplished by providing actual value in the information you’re presenting. Now, providing enough info to be useful, but still making them want more – that’s the art of it. That is, they have to be wanting more when you refer them to the product sales page for the product you’re trying to sell. And since they’re more open, they are more likely to make a purchase.
The science component
There are also several key elements that need to be included.
The first is how you present the information. You have to have your end in mind. Your goal is to sell the product you’re promoting. There are two ways to accomplish this with great content. The first method is to provide enough info to get them started, but not enough to finish. The other method is to explain all the details and expose how difficult it is to do what you’re explaining. Either way, the product sales page solves the problem.
But you can’t link to your affiliate link. Instead you link directly to the product sales page. This increases your clicks. But how are you going to get credit for the sale, if you don’t include your affiliate link? Well, that’s part of the science of this whole process. You use the “covert cookie” strategy.
You also want to link to the sales page from inside your article’s content. Hyperlinked words are clicked more than anything else. Plus, if you link on relevant words, it only makes sense to click on there.
Using this system, you’re virtually guaranteed to increase your affiliate business success.
OK, here’s the not-so-good news:
It’s extremely difficult to do this correctly. Let’s look at the skills required to pull it off: Great content. First of all, you actually have to write great articles and give value to your readers. To do that you have to have enough information to be valuable and be able to present it in a useful way. Strategic writing. Yes, you must providing useful content. You also have to present the info in a way that provides real value. And somehow also make them want to learn more. Or make the information so overwhelming they realize they can’t do it on their own.
Picking products. After that you have to figure out which products you want to promote. If you can manage to get the article written well. You’ve wasted all your effort if the product doesn’t sell well.
Technical skills. And finally, you need the technical know-how to embed your image tag and make sure you get credit for the sale. This is actually pretty simple – just embed a 1 pixel X 1 pixel image and set your affiliate link as the “source” of the image. (But if you mess it up, your referrals won’t be tracked.)
